I think that pushing the clocks is their only real option.
If I was to guess, I think that Sony was thinking of launching PS5 last year like alot of the rumours were saying. They then decided not to, but had already sunk their money into a 36CU, 8.xtflop APU. Stadia came out at over 10, and MS heavily rumoured to be 12tflops.
So the cheapest fix was to
A) Increase the clocks to the max (2.0ghz).
B) Use all 40CUs on their die and accept a higher cost per unit due to failures.
Now while there will be a higher % of non usable dies off the wafer, the APU is smaller than the XSX and so they will get more APUs off a wafer than MS does on theirs. So it might work out to be the same cost per die in the end as MS.
Well, that's my guess anyway.
